Roulette
The name Roulette is derived from the French word Wheel and is believed to have originated from somewhere in France, probably in Paris. Blaise Pascal a mathematician who was from the 17th century had invented this unique spinning wheel and thereafter it underwent a number of modifications and changes. Finally when it reached the US the additional ‘00’ was incorporated on to the existing wheel which increased the house edge, but gave the players a hard time to win. The American and the European Roulette became increasingly popular and the dawn of the 1990s saw an online version coming into existence. This was an answer to all those roulette fans who loved to play the game from their own preferred venues and locations, and nowadays, with regard to gambling room games, online roulette is more popular than at land based casinos.

Online roulette comprises of different bets such as inside, outside and odd bets and the outcome of the ball coming to rest when the spinning wheel comes to a halt, determines the result. You can bet on colors, numbers, columns, dozens of numbers etc, and the wagering choices are quite a few in a game of roulette. Roulette can make you huge earnings if you play with the correct strategy and the correct game version… the gambling game odds are better on the European version. Blackjack
Blackjack is believed to have started in the 17th century in France as well and was originally called Vingt Et Un, meaning 21, however there are differences between Vingt Et Un and Blackjack. In Vingt Et Un you are allowed to bet while the dealer is allowed to double quite contrary to the blackjack of these days. However, the objective is the same in getting as close to 21 as possible without exceeding the number, and you will get paid a high payout if you get the natural blackjack. The game is played with 8 packs of cards and the cards are reshuffled at regular intervals.

Once you have decided on your wagering amount and are seated at the table which corresponds to your wager, you would have to confirm your bet to be accepted into playing the game. When the game commences players will be dealt 2 cards face up while the dealer one face up and the other face down. At this point all the strategy you have studied and practiced has to be applied, whether it is simple or a complex card counting strategy because you are playing against the dealer and as such no other player matters. The decision to hit, stand, double or split is left entirely up to you and this is where your blackjack skills are put to test. You should be able to judge the next card of the dealers and play judiciously such that you better your hand against the dealers. Bingo
Bingo is thought to have originated in Italy where it was once called “Il Giuoco del Lotto d'Italia' in 1530. Over the years the rules have been adapted and changed to become the game it is today however the objective is still the same. There are few kinds of bingo but 75-ball and 90-ball bingo are the most widely played. The rules of 75-ball bingo involves using a bingo card with a 5x5 grid with 24 numbers and an empty space displayed in it. As the caller reads out numbers from 1-75, the players mark the numbers off the card. The first player that marks off all of their numbers is the winner. The rules of 90-ball bingo involves using a bingo card with a 3x9 grid with 15 numbers and the rest are left as empty spaces. The first player that marks off all of their numbers is the winner.

Craps
Craps is an exciting game of dice and is known to have been played in 600 BC. The French brought the game over in the 19th century and then around 1931 it became famous in the US. A game of dice with no real strategy to decide what the outcome of the dice roll would be, Craps is still an exciting and thrilling game. All the noise and the din from a casino will be invariably arising from the craps table as each player is so anxious to know the next outcome.

There are different bets on which a game of craps is played and though the bets may look a little complex they fall into place as the game progresses. The common bets are Passline/don’t passline and come/don’t come bets. They all evolve around the 7 and 11 concept being rolled, and if some other number is rolled it is declared a point or craps, depending on the outcome. The come out roll is the first roll and in the event of a 7 or an 11 being rolled then that round has won, or else craps have been rolled out. Poker
Poker is the most popular of card games and requires skill and strategy to be able to play a successful game. The World Series of Poker and the World Poker Tour prove the importance of this game, and whether you are at a casino in Las Vegas or on your online casino gambling website, you still have the unique experience that this game offers. Playing for fun before you play this strategic game is recommended so that you can play a smarter game, if you are conversant with the terminology and the strategy this game requires.

Poker offers some variations like Draw Poker, Stud Poker, and Community Card Poker and each game has specific rules. In a game of draw poker 5 cards are dealt which are hidden and the players strive to improve those hands by either replacing them or holding onto what they originally have been dealt. While in Stud Poker the players receive a mix of face up and face down cards and the objective is to get the best winning hand. Community Card Poker comprises of Texas Hold’em and Omaha Hold’em these are complex and difficult games so long as you have your facts and figures correct, they can be relaxing and challenging.
